BABA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2022 in Review

1,172 of the 6,221 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Alibaba (BABA) for Q4 2022, worth a combined $33.7B — up 14% from $29.6B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 191 funds opened new BABA positions and 140 closed out — a net gain of 51 holders — while 291 added to existing stakes and 482 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Coatue Management, adding an estimated $378M. The largest seller was Credit Agricole, cutting an estimated $635M.
